Global Feed Mycotoxin Detoxifiers Market to Surpass USD 3.8 Billion by 2035 Amid Rising Demand for Natural Solutions in Livestock Feed

The global Feed Mycotoxin Detoxifiers Market is poised for robust expansion, projected to grow from USD 2,091.5 million in 2025 to USD 3,823.9 million by 2035, exhibiting a CAGR of 6.2% during the forecast period. This upward trajectory reflects the increasing adoption of feed safety solutions in livestock production, driven by rising concerns about mycotoxin contamination and its adverse effects on animal health and productivity.

As feed quality becomes a key determinant of animal wellness and farm profitability, livestock producers are steadily turning toward detoxifiers that mitigate the risks of harmful mycotoxins such as aflatoxins, ochratoxins, and fumonisins. With regulatory frameworks tightening around feed safety, feed manufacturers are integrating mycotoxin detoxification strategies into their production cycles — fueling demand across both developed and emerging economies.

Market Dynamics:

The rising emphasis on sustainable agriculture and organic livestock practices is significantly influencing the demand for natural feed mycotoxin detoxifiers. Modern consumers are increasingly concerned about food safety and environmental integrity, compelling producers to reduce their carbon footprint and dependence on synthetic feed additives.

This shift is creating lucrative opportunities for detoxifiers derived from plant-based materials or beneficial microbial cultures, which not only enhance animal immunity but also align with organic certification standards. Furthermore, heightened awareness of the economic losses associated with mycotoxin contamination — including reduced feed conversion rates and reproductive failures — continues to drive global demand.

Country-wise Market Analysis (2035):

United States
The U.S. leads the global market, projected to reach USD 611.8 million by 2035. Strong regulatory oversight from the FDA and a mature livestock industry are driving consistent investment in advanced feed additives.

Germany
Germany’s market is expected to hit USD 420.6 million by 2035. The country’s push for antibiotic-free livestock farming and stringent EU food safety laws support the adoption of detoxifier solutions.

China
China is forecast to achieve USD 305.9 million in market value by 2035. A growing demand for premium animal protein and government support for feed innovation are fueling growth.

India
India’s market will reach USD 191.2 million by 2035. The expanding poultry and dairy sectors are encouraging the use of safe and efficient detoxifiers to boost animal health and yields.

Brazil
Brazil is expected to reach USD 76.5 million in 2035. The country’s export-driven meat industry is embracing feed detoxifiers to meet international food safety standards.
